Farmington Water Park Announces Temporary Closure Following Medical Emergency
Farmington, Missouri (July 21, 2026) – The Farmington Water Park will be closed on Tuesday, July 21, 2026, following a near-drowning incident at the facility.
Shortly after 8:00pm on Monday, July 20, 2026, a child was observed unresponsive and taken from the pool by a lifeguard. A staff member from the St. Francois County Ambulance District was on site at the time and immediately began administering CPR. The child regained responsiveness at the Water Park and was transported by helicopter to Cardinal Glennon Children’s Hospital.
To allow staff time to debrief following the incident, the Water Park will be closed on Tuesday, July 21, 2026. The splash pad will remain open from 9:00am to 6:00pm and will be free of charge for the day.
Out of respect for the privacy of the child and their family, no further information is available at this time.
